    Banita Sandhu opens up about being called ugly after doing a South Indian film: ‘I looked like a twig, how could the co-star be attracted to me…’

    Actress Banita Sandhu recently shared her personal experience with body shaming and the emotional complexities that accompanied it. Banita recalled facing harsh criticism early in her career and recounted one such experience in the South Indian film industry.Banita Sandhu about facing body shaming and trollsIn an interview with ANI, she shared that she was called “ugly” after doing a South Indian film. “I remember getting body-shamed when I did a South Indian movie. I remember people calling me ugly because I looked like a twig. And how could the co-star be attracted to me in the movie because I was so skinny,” she said.She found it bizarre, and the trolling on social media felt particularly strange to her, as she had grown up in a different environment with a different culture. The Sardar Udham actress was born and raised in Caerleon, Wales. “So I didn’t feel as closely offended or criticised by it. I was like, oh, okay, the beauty standard in this region is different from what I look like. And that’s just how I took it. I didn’t take it to heart, like, ‘Oh my God, I need to gain so much weight now.’ I’m naturally very skinny – you can literally ask any producer I’ve worked with; I eat the most on set,” she added.

    Banita Sandhu take on negative comments onlineBanita also addressed the wider culture of online criticism and revealed that she had often received such negative comments from people. According to her, such remarks should not be taken seriously.Abhout Banita Sandhu ‘s career Her journey in cinema began with Shoojit Sircar’s October in 2018, where she starred opposite Varun Dhawan. She shared that it was a blessing for her to start her career with such a renowned director. Following her debut, Banita went on to appear in the American sci-fi series Pandora and the Tamil film ‘Adithya Varma’.Upcoming movieShe is now gearing up for the release of ‘Detective Sherdil’, opposite Diljit Dosanjh. The film, directed and edited by Ravi Chhabriya, features an ensemble cast including Diana Penty, Boman Irani, Ratna Pathak Shah, Chunky Panday, Sumeet Vyas, and Kashmira Irani. The film is scheduled for release on June 20.
